Product Description
This thick & cosy scarflet came about because of a challenge!
A fellow blogger friend of mine sent me a lovely 100gm skein of cashmerino which she had dyed herself.
She said we both had 1 week to design something each from identical skeins of this yarn.
3 months later we finished! I designed this scarflet. The original pattern in cashmerino is also available with my lovecrochet profile.
This version uses a yarn which is actually in a super chunky brand called Moda Vera Shiver (see yarnsub.com for substitute yarns). I liked the original pattern so much I created another variation in the super chunky.
Both scarflet patterns are available on my blog redhairedamazona.blogspot.com.au as FREE tutorials.
But as some of my readers also like a PDF to print and take with them, I have made PDFs available for the super low price of US$1.
You will need 150gm of a super chunky yarn, an 8mm crochet hook, 2 faux fur pompoms (or normal yarn ones you can make yourself), darning needle and scissors.
